I have a 96 SL2 Base Auto. I feel safe driving in winding backwood roads, but would prefer more visibility than what my headlights currently offer. I have no idea where to start. I do know that the state I live in requires all aftermarket lighting equipment be DOT or SAE approved. I'm not afraid to work on the car myself, but not comfortable at all to touch the CPU.

Fog lights...
Switch, two lights with bracket, some fuse box parts, and 20 minutes work... Parts can be found in a junkyard... A 9011 bulb can be used instead of the 9005/9006 headlight bulb, with some modification to the base. Or Silverstar Ultra's...

You basically have two options: A: Replace your headlights with something brighter. Too bright is not DOT compliant. At least not on-road. B: Add driving lights (basically the same thing as fog lights but not yellow). Aiming the lights too high (where they would blind oncoming traffic) or adding too bright of lights is not DOT compliant. |
